Let's dive into the specifics of each role and how they contribute to the gaming industry: 1. **Game Designer:** Game designers are responsible for crafting the concept, mechanics, and levels of a game. With a 30% share of the market, game designers are essential to the game development process, creating engaging and immersive experiences that captivate players. 2. **Game Developer:** Game developers bring game designs to life, writing the code that drives game mechanics and functionality. With a 25% share of the market, game developers collaborate closely with designers and artists to ensure a seamless and enjoyable gaming experience. 3. **Game Artist:** Game artists create the visual elements that help bring games to life, responsible for concept art, character design, and environmental art. With a 20% share of the market, game artists are crucial to the industry, providing the visual appeal that attracts and retains players. 4. **Game Producer:** As the project manager, game producers coordinate all aspects of a game's development, ensuring deadlines are met and resources are allocated effectively. With a 15% share of the market, game producers play a vital role in keeping development on track and delivering high-quality games to the public. 5. **Game Tester:** Game testers ensure the functionality and playability of a game by identifying and reporting bugs, glitches, or other issues. With a 10% share of the market, game testers help ensure the final product meets the desired quality standards and is free of critical errors.
